The FA’s Football Leadership

Diversity Code Careers Platform 

To support the FA’s commitment to ED&I across English football, we developed the FLDC Careers platform. Providing football clubs across English football access to advertise vacancies and attract new talent, it aims to Increase equality of opportunity and support the drive for diversity and inclusion across English football.

PARIS 2024 Olympic Games Talent Platform

Supporting Paris 2024 in the challenge of building a world class events workforce with the diversity of skills and attributes needed to host the Olympic games. Delivering a Multi-language Careers platform to advertise all vacancies, build the Paris 2024 brand position and attract the best global talent while building an all-important ‘future talent’ database through the bespoke platform.

CIMPSA Aggregated Jobs Board Platform

Global Sports delivered a high volume, quality-focused jobs board platform for the sport and physical activity sector in partnership with CIMSPA as part of their 'retrain to retain' COVID-19 pandemic recovery programme.
